./conf
is a special directory where well name files are injected inside the slapd configuration upon container boot. All the files inside are processed with frep to react, adapt, and replace some parameters inside with environement values./conf/slapd.conf
(default) is a special directory where well name files are injected inside the slapd configuration upon container boot./conf/schema/*
schema to use./conf/slapd.repl
syncrepl instruction for replication,
the default template dumpsSLAPD_SYNCREPL
environment variable
which should be a oneline BASE64 encoded string./conf/slapd.acls
ACLs to apply on DIT,
the default template dumpsSLAPD_ACLS
environment variable
which should be a oneline BASE64 encoded string./conf/slapd.d/*
(not finished)
- see .env.dist to start a configuration
- Those variables need to be encoded to base64 without newlines (a one line (
\n
removed)):SLAPD_SYNCREPL
: syncrepl configuration lines to add (bare slapd.conf configuration lines)SLAPD_ACLS
: acl configuration lines to add (bare slapd.conf configuration lines)
-
Notifications
You must be signed in to change notification settings - Fork 0
corpusops/docker-slapd
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Folders and files
Name | Name | Last commit message | Last commit date | |
---|---|---|---|---|
Repository files navigation
About
ansible+docker based slapd setup
Topics
Resources
Stars
Watchers
Forks
Releases
No releases published
Packages 0
No packages published